Alicia Ellis decided to write books about ten minutes before graduating from law school. She's now an Atlanta attorney, but she moonlights as an author, electronics junkie, and secret superhero. With two degrees in computer science and an MFA in writing popular fiction, Alicia loves all things high-tech and unreal. She writes science fiction and fantasy. Her debut novel, Girl of Flesh and Metal, made the American Library Association's LITA Excellence in Children's and Young Adult Science Fiction Notable Lists.
